New Delhi, May 7 -- The Indian Army on Wednesday launched 'Operation Sindoor' that lasted for 25 minutes at nine terror hideouts belonging to banned organisations Jaish-e-Mohammed, Lashkar-e-Taiba, and Hizbul Mujahideen in Pakistan and PoK. The missiles struck four locations within Pakistan's territory, while five targets were situated in Pakistan-occupied Kashmir.
